170. Deputy Pearse Doherty asked the Minister for Finance further to Parliamentary Question No. 46 of 12 December 2012, and further to a report in a national newspaper (details supplied) which states in relation to Custom House Capital that the collapse of the entity will leave the State out of pocket by €15 million, if he will reconfirm that the Investor Compensation Company Limited is entirely self-funding. [1552/13]
